To: Redevelopment Commission
From: Bill Schalliol, Economic Development Planner
Subject: Resolutions 2602 and 2603 — Fred's Transmission
Date: September 29, 2009
Attached to this staff report are Resolutions 2602 and 2603 which relates to property at 501 W.
Western Avenue in the Coveleski Neighborhood Planning Area within the South Bend Central
Development Area. This parcel was added to the South Bend Central Development Area
acquisition list by Resolution 2595 on August 26, 2009.

Resolution 2602
The purpose of Resolution 2602 is to set the acquisition value for the property commonly known as
Fred's Transmission located at 501 W Western Avenue. The average appraised value as
determined by two qualified appraisers is $204,000.00. This value is for a 24,394 SF ( +/- .56 acres)
lot with one 7,000 SF commercial structure. The parcel sits on the northwest corner of the
intersection of Western and William and covers up almost the entire southern end of the block area
which is designated the Housing Block in the Coveleski Park planning efforts. With a purchase of
the Fred's Transmission parcel, the Redevelopment Commission would own all but three parcels on
this block (See attached map).
Resolution 2603
After intense negotiations with the property owners concerning the appraised value of the property,
a counter offer in the amount of Two Hundred and Fifty Thousand Dollars ($250,000.00), with an
additional amount of Twelve Thousand Five Hundred Dollars ($12,500.00) for relocation is being
proposed as part of the counter value purchase resolution. After reviewing the appraisal information
(high appraisal value at $240,000), the current tax assessment value ($247,500) and values paid in
this area ($10.25/SF), this counter value is similar to the values of other properties within this area
and is a reasonable number for this parcel. When acquired, the site will be cleared to facilitate new
development in the Coveleski Park Planning Area.
Summary
Staff requests favorable approval of Resolutions 2602 and 2603. The value is reasonable and
consistent with values paid to others in the neighborhood. This is a key parcel and is adjacent to
other property owned by the Commission.

RESOLUTION NO. 2602
A RESOLUTION OF THE SOUTH BEND REDEVELOPMENT COMMISSION
RELATED TO ACQUISITION OF PROPERTY IN THE
SOUTH BEND CENTRAL DEVELOPMENT AREA
WHEREAS, under the authority granted by Indiana Code § 36 -7 -14, et seq. and
in furtherance of the South Bend Central Development Area Plan ( "Plan "), the South
Bend Redevelopment Commission ( "Commission ") has determined that it is necessary to
acquire unencumbered fee simple interest in certain property located within the area
heretofore designated as the South Bend Central Development Area (the "Area ") within
the City of South Bend, Indiana (the "City "), which property is more particularly
described at Exhibit A attached hereto and incorporated herein ( "Property "); and
WHEREAS, on August 26, 2009, the Commission adopted Resolution No.
2595 amending the Plan and adding the Property to the Area's acquisition list; and
WHEREAS, two (2) independent appraisals of the Property have been obtained
in accordance with Indiana Code § 36- 7- 14- 19(b), which provide an offering price of
$204,000.00 (the "Offering Price "); and
WHEREAS, the Commission now desires to authorize its authorized agents,
hired for such purposes, or the staff of the Commission to provide and negotiate an offer
for the Purchase of the Property in accordance with Indiana Code § 36- 7- 14-19, which
may include relocation costs and the Commission's payment of expenses incidental to the
conveyance and determination of the title of the Property; and
WHEREAS, the Commission finds that all procedures necessary for
authorizing and acquiring the Property have been completed in accordance with Indiana
law;
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ED by the South Bend
Redevelopment Commission that:
1. Authorized agents of the Commission and the staff of the Commission are
hereby authorized and directed to cause a purchase offer to be made in writing to the
owner(s) of the Property as described at Exhibit A at the Offering Price (the "Average
Acquisition Price" in Exhibit A) in accordance with Indiana Code § 36- 7- 14-19, which
offer or process may include relocation costs and the payment of expenses incidental to
the conveyance and determination of the title of the Property.
2. The Commission's agents and attorneys are hereby authorized and
directed to negotiate and prepare documentation necessary to accomplish the acquisition
of the Property in accordance with this Resolution and in a form acceptable to legal
counsel.
3. The Commission hereby ratifies any actions of its staff or legal counsel
previously taken consistent with the authority provided in Section 1 or 2 hereof.
Notwithstanding the foregoing, no representations, contract or understanding relative to
the purchase of the Property, whether made by a Commissioner, employee or other agent
or official, is binding against the Commission until approved and accepted by the
Commission in writing. The Commission hereby accepts, in advance, any purchase of
the Property pursuant to a uniform acquisition offer set forth at Indiana Code § 32 -24-1-
5 (or a purchase offer deemed by legal counsel to be substantially similar to said Uniform
Acquisition Offer, which may include the payment of expenses incidental to the
conveyance and determination of title).
4. Don Inks or Jeff Gibney is authorized to execute on behalf of the
Commission any documents necessary to carry out the intent of this resolution.
ADOPTED at a Regular Meeting of the South Bend Redevelopment
Commission held on October 2, 2009, at 1308 County -City Building, 227 West Jefferson
Boulevard, South Bend, Indiana 46601.
